    I have a Chuwi Vi10 Pro and tried this fix. Although the blurry text seems to be better now I also lost the touchscreen, Wifi and Bluetooth functionality. Anyway to revert this or get this working again? [EDIT] I fixed this by flashing boot.img from the latest Android image. Looks a bit blurry but I’m not even sure it’s the same, better or worse. I will live with it.

    Hi, I’m having the same issue, but don’t know how to flash boot.img. I have all the tools installed on my computer, downloaded the android rom and rooted my tablet. Could you please give a quick instruction? Thanks.

    Download the lastest Android image here: https://drive.google.com/file/d/0B_WhOdPMvW1OVElJMGp6LXlnSDQ/view?usp=sharing Extract boot.img from this download and flash it by replacing the boot.img from the tool which T.Money created for the blurry text fix. It will flash the boot.img from the latest Android image instead of the boot.img with the blurry text fix (which will render your touchscreen useless in some cases appearently).
